Question
what is the true solution to (2 ln 4x = 2 ln 8)?
- (x = -4)
- (x = -2)
- (x = 2)
- (x = 4)
⚡ Using what you learned: Logarithms and Exponential Equations
Step 1: Simplify the equation
Divide both sides of the equation by \( 2 \):
$$
\ln(4x) = \ln(8)
$$
Step 2: Equate the arguments
Since the natural logarithm function is one-to-one, we can set the arguments equal to each other:
$$
4x = 8
$$
Step 3: Solve for x
Divide both sides by \( 4 \):
$$
x = 2
$$
Step 4: Verify the solution
Check if \( x = 2 \) is in the domain of the original logarithmic expression (the argument must be positive):
$$
4x = 4(2) = 8 > 0
$$
Since the argument is positive, \( x = 2 \) is a true solution.
